WebMay 6, 2024 · In addition to protein, crickets are high in many other nutrients, including fat, calcium, potassium, zinc, magnesium, copper, folate, biotin, pantothenic acid, and iron. … WebSep 21, 2024 · The insects’ muscles contract to produce chirping, based on chemical reactions. The warmer the temperature, the easier the cricket’s muscles activate, so the chirps increase. The cooler the temperature, the slower the reaction rate, and the less frequent the chirps. WebJul 7, 2012 · Crickets perceive air movements using hundreds of filiform mechanosensory hairs located on the cerci. Axons from these mechanosensory receptors project into the terminal abdominal ganglion (TAG) and connect to local and projecting interneurons. The reference is to "the sound of crickets chirping," as in, "very peaceful, not a single voice … エンドリーク 症状WebProblem-based task that can be used to drive the teaching and learning in this unit varies After reading about the use of crickets for human consumption as a food source, students write a response to the following question: How can the addition of crickets make school lunches more nutritious? panto car gta 5WebNov 14, 2013 · Crickets exhibit oriented walking behavior in response to air-current stimuli. Because crickets move in the opposite direction from the stimulus source, this behavior is considered to represent ‘escape behavior’ from an approaching predator.
